1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which of the following is a correct header line for main in a Java program? Options: public static void main(args), public static void main(String args), public static void main(args [ ]), public static void main(String [ ] args)
Back
public static void main(String [ ] args)
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does a comment look like in Java?
Back
//comment
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A variable that holds a whole number
Back
int
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A variable that holds words
Back
String
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A variable that holds true or false
Back
boolean
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A variable that holds a character
Back
char
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the file extension for Java Source Code?
Back
.java
